Released , 'Kaake Da Viyah' stars Karamjit Anmol, Jordan Sandhu, Priti Sapru, Nirmal Rishi The movie has a runtime of about 2 hr 13 min, and received a user score of 60 (out of 100) on TMDb, which put together reviews from 1 knowledgeable users.
Want to know what the movie's about? Here's the plot: "A guys family wants him to get married but it is harder than he thought On one hand his grandmother wants him to get married to a girl of her choice and on the other his mother is eager to select a girl for him On top of that he is already in love with a girl His dilemma of being stuck between three women forms the crux of the story"
'Kaake Da Viyah' is currently available to rent, purchase, or stream via subscription on Netflix .
